I\u2019ve got a little audio coming up on this. This is eerie to sit here and watch a congressional committee go after a private citizen, Roger Clemens and this trainer up there, Brian McNamee. Now, I followed this. I understand what this is all about, but to paraphrase Bill Clinton, no hearing on steroids in baseball ever fed a hungry child. I don\u2019t know what Clemens is doing there. Has he lied to Congress before his deposition this week or did they call him up there because of the Mitchell Report and he went public and said The Mitchell Report\u2019s not true so then Congress said we want to get in the act? So I think that may be Congress\u2019 reason for wanting to get involved in this. Look, nobody recommends people take HGH or steroids, athletes, kids being influenced by it and all that, but it\u2019s sort of like Congress wanting to get involved in the New England Patriots spying on opposing teams. The league\u2019s supposed to handle this kind of stuff. It\u2019s really up to the league. They can hold over the anti-trust exemption over baseball. We\u2019re going to remove it, we\u2019re not going to give you that exemption anymore so baseball has to cooperate, go out and do this dog and pony show. I don\u2019t know what\u2019s happened since the program started today at noon Eastern, but before that it seemed to me that the Democrats on the committee were sort of siding with the trainer, McNamee, and really sticking it to Clemens. You go to the Republicans, and they seem to be sticking it to the trainer and defending Clemens, and I got two sound bites here. Dan Burton is on this committee, Republican, and in his session here, Dan Burton leads the trainer, Brian McNamee, down a list of his previous lies. Burton says, &#8216;Mr. McNamee, I\u2019m going to read to you a series of prior statements attributed to you regarding steroid use or the lack thereof by Mr. Clemens or Mr. Pettitte. &#8216;I never gave Clemens or Pettitte steroids. They never asked me for steroids. The only thing they asked me for were vitamins.\u2019 That was William Sherman and T. J. Quinn. [A story headlined] Andy Totes Baggage to Bronx in the New York Daily News, December 10th, 2006. Did you say that Andy Pettitte and Roger Clemens, you never gave them steroids, did you say all that is?\u2019<\/p>\n<p>MCNAMEE: Yes, I did.<\/p>\n<p>BURTON: Is that a lie? <\/p>\n<p>MCNAMEE: Yes, it is.<\/p>\n<p>BURTON: Oh, it\u2019s another one. Okay. &#8216;I told federal investigators twice that Roger and Andy had nothing to do with it.\u2019 Is that right?<\/p>\n<p>MCNAMEE: Yes, sir.<\/p>\n<p>BURTON: Is that a lie?<\/p>\n<p>MCNAMEE: Yes, sir.<\/p>\n<p>BURTON: Mr. McNamee, I\u2019m going to read you a series of statements attributed to you regarding your involvement with steroids. &#8216;I don\u2019t have any dealings with steroids or amphetamines. I don\u2019t buy it, sell it, condone it, or recommend it. I don\u2019t make money from it. It\u2019s not part of my livelihood and not part of my business.\u2019 Did you say that?<\/p>\n<p>MCNAMEE: Yep.<\/p>\n<p>BURTON: That\u2019s a lie, right?<\/p>\n<p>MCNAMEE: Partial.<\/p>\n<p>BURTON: Partial?<\/p>\n<p>MCNAMEE: Partial lie.<\/p>\n<p>BURTON: (laughing) &#8216;McNamee pleads guilty to knowing the ins and outs of steroids but says I have no involvement as far as supplying it, getting it, selling it, telling them to use it. Jon Heyman, The Sixth Man, Clemen\u2019s trainer, denies link to Grimsley &#8212; is that a lie?\u2019 <\/p>\n<p>MCNAMEE: Yes.<\/p>\n<p>RUSH: Then Burton unloaded.<\/p>\n<p>BURTON: This is really disgusting. You\u2019re here as a sworn witness. You\u2019re here to tell the truth. You\u2019re here under oath, and yet we have lie after lie after lie after lie where you told this committee and the people of this country that Roger Clemens did things &#8212; I don\u2019t know what to believe. I know one thing I don\u2019t believe, and that\u2019s you. Roger Clemens is a titan in baseball, and you with all these lies, if they\u2019re not true, are destroying him and his reputation. Now, how does he get his reputation back if this is not true? And how can we believe you, because you\u2019ve lied and lied and lied and lied? If he\u2019s done something wrong, he ought to be indicted, he ought to be prosecuted, and he ought to be punished for it. But I don\u2019t see any evidence of that so far. And, with that, I\u2019ll stop.<\/p>\n<p>RUSH: And at that point, &#8216;Nostrilitis\u2019 Waxman banged the gavel and said, &#8216;The gentleman\u2019s time has expired.\u2019 But that was Burton unloading, and the Republicans generally have been unloading &#8212; at least before noon, on the trainer McNamee, and the Democrats have been unloading on Clemens.
